The substitution of which group increases the antiseptic action?(a) Methyl(b) Ethyl(c) Aromatic(d) All of the mentionedThis question was addressed to me in homework.Enquiry is from Effects of Alkylation topic in portion Alkylation of Unit Processes

Answer»

The correct choice is (a) Methyl

Best EXPLANATION: Phenol was the FIRST antiseptic used, and a thorough study of its derivatives has been made. The SUBSTITUTION of a methyl group for the hydrogen in the ring of phenol, forming the CRESOLS, INCREASES the antiseptic action.
